We put so much stock into originality.  But I wonder, In this day and age, is there even such a thing as original thought?  Think of the millions upon millions of people who have walked this earth.  Is there a sentence that has never been uttered?  A thought that has never been thought?  A conversation that has never been repeated?  And how would we ever know? 

We are all products of our environment and genetics.  We are molded by the society in which we live.  How much of what I say is actually my own?  How many times have you said "I was just about to say that"?  Or "That sounds just like something I could have written myself"?

Does originality even exist anymore?

I would sure hope so.
